Some of the most famous parks in Malabar Hill include Gandhi Baug, the Hanging Gardens, and the nearby Carter Road promenade.
Bandra is popular for its cultural vibrancy and strong community. The Bandra Bandstand and Carter Road promenade are well-known for their scenic views and well-maintained facilities.
The Worli Sea Face park is known for its stunning sunsets, well-maintained lawns, children's play areas, and various seating options. It offers a relaxing atmosphere and panoramic views of the Arabian Sea.
The presence of these parks enhances the quality of life for residents and adds significant value to the properties in the vicinity. They are highly sought after by luxury home buyers and contribute to the overall appeal of the area.
Other notable parks in Mumbai include the Mahalaxmi Race Course in Parel, the Dr. Bhau Daji Lad Museum Garden in Byculla, and the K. C. Gandhi Udyan in Worli.
